Although it's a challenging product, installers still locate Galvalume very easy to handle, rollform, cut, and beyond. One of the top selling factors of Galvalume is the 25.5-year service warranty on the substratum, which is often described as a perforation service warranty. Galvalume systems additionally commonly come with paint service warranties that better protect your financial investment and offer satisfaction that the roof covering or wall surface system will last (substratum or paint warranties are NOT available for Galvalume products within 1,500 feet of a coastline).

Oil canning is a fundamental particular of light-gauge, cold-formed steel products, particularly items with wide level areas. It is an aesthetic phenomenon seen as waviness or distortion in the level surfaces of steel wall surface and roof items. Oil canning is subjective and normally only a visual problem that does not affect a product's toughness or efficiency.

Galvalume does ideal when not in call with copper, lead, blocks, dealt with lumber, iron, and concrete. If Galvalume is in contact with one of these and is after that introduced to an electrolyte such as water, it can lead to galvanic corrosion of the steel. Its substances, normally light weight aluminum sulfates, are chemically damaged down using electrolysis/electrolytic reduction to produce the aluminum metal product. One of the most significant benefits of light weight aluminum is that it can be mounted in coastal atmospheres.


Because aluminum oxidizes as it begins to wear away, it in fact makes it more powerful and lengthens the life of the system on the coastline. Best of all, aluminum roofing systems still lug a PVDF paint guarantee when set up in seaside locations (weathercraft). Aluminum metal roofing systems come with a range of warranty options, including paint, substrate, and weathertight service warranties, which aid to safeguard your financial investment and provide satisfaction that the roofing or wall system will last


This aids to protect the steel and make it last in really destructive atmospheres, like coastlines. And also, the oxidation types instead promptly, so there's no edge creep that consumes the panel like a steel substrate with red rust. Light weight aluminum is just one of the lightest metal products, particularly contrasted to steel products.

Steel is usually recyclable somehow, and light weight aluminum is among the most multiple-use and lasting metals in the globe. For referral, about 95% of all Bonuses aluminum roof mounted worldwide are made from previously recycled light weight aluminum products. At Sheffield Metals, we make use of a 3000 series aluminum alloy (3105) primarily made from previously recycled materials and extremely little pure aluminum.


Aluminum standing joint steel roofings come in at concerning $7 to $18 per square foot relying on thickness, coating, profile, area, installer, and lots of various other elements. Light weight aluminum is much more malleable than steel, which means it can be curved and adjusted much a lot more quickly and will not endure breaks or cracks. Nonetheless, it has likewise been recognized to dent much easier than other steels throughout and after the installment.


This is something that professionals need to be knowledgeable about throughout the setup to permit enough area for the thermal movement of the panels. This is specifically crucial when utilizing a mechanically seamed panel in sizes above 15-20 feet. For panels this length, it's suggested that an expansion clip be used per the applicable design.

Making use of a bare aluminum product with its initial natural silver-gray shade isn't typically recommended. As the metal ages, experiences weathering, and oxidizes (white rust), it doesn't hold its initial mill-finished shade and often becomes rinsed and spotty. The very best method to conquer this problem is to purchase painted roof covering coils or panels, which will certainly age much cleaner over time since the paint covers any one of the metal color adjustments.

Studies have shown that zinc roofing can in some cases last as much as 150 years, depending upon the top quality of installation, structure residential properties, and climate. Considering that zinc is a natural steel drawn out from the ground, zinc's toxicity levels are reduced, even after construction. House owners and company owners do not need to bother with hazardous run-off or ground pollution bordering their zinc roofing.
